Venue: The Harbour Gallery, St Aubin [map]
Join us in our new home - The Harbour Gallery, Le Boulevard, St Aubin, St Brelade, JE3 8AB. Come and see the 3 new galleries. Apart from local artists there are works by David Hockney, L.S. Lowry and Henry Moore.
|
To be officially opened on Friday, 22 November at 6.30pm by His Excellency the Lieutenant Governor, Air Chief Marshall Sir John Cheshire KBE CB and our patron Lady Cheshire.

Venue: Gallery Rendez-Vous des Arts, St Aubin [map]
Join us in our 1st anniversary celebrations - an exhibition of paintings and 3D pieces, with a maritime theme, produced by artists working in Jersey.
|
To be officially opened on Thursday, 12 September at 6.30pm by Vice Admiral Sir Peter Woodhead KCB.
